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ton announced the arrest of a judge and several other officials in connection with alleged vote harvesting activities. The arrests stemmed from an investigation into practices aimed at manipulating the electoral process, a serious concern as upcoming elections approach.
The indicted individuals include a county judge and several local officials, all accused of engaging in illegal tactics to collect and submit ballots. Paxton characterized these actions as egregious violations of election integrity, emphasizing the importance of protecting the democratic process.
Paxton’s office initiated the investigation after reports surfaced suggesting that the officials had solicited voters to fill out ballots and then submitted them on their behalf, potentially subverting the will of the electorate.
